Transaction 2f90023cb407bb4043f7b2384d54c28fdf21b9b84375a60119863a3e6ad99165

1 Input
2 Outputs
  • 2f90023cb407bb4043f7b2384d54c28fdf21b9b84375a60119863a3e6ad99165:0
  • value  398567519116
    address  mkdzMemVTMf34btzxPSLdhYBGJvtwjS24h
  • 2f90023cb407bb4043f7b2384d54c28fdf21b9b84375a60119863a3e6ad99165:1
  • value  158677722
    address  2NBMEX5gbaHN9aUNuBZrmZEjy657EVG27QV